Transaction 1f1b39124476a50e54d0ece204fbcae69f7eb35d2d400e8e27ef3bfe30d4bd5e
1 Input
2 Outputs
- 1f1b39124476a50e54d0ece204fbcae69f7eb35d2d400e8e27ef3bfe30d4bd5e:0
- 1f1b39124476a50e54d0ece204fbcae69f7eb35d2d400e8e27ef3bfe30d4bd5e:1
value 21300000
address 3JEgdmm21tmY13PypX5JveRAh8VMnNYVhG
value 28666500
address 172TnggAJRzVpwzmhgpAvYMkMkBUbgTV6N